关闭

HTML5语法中3个要点

346人阅读 评论(0) 收藏 举报
分类:

一.可以省略的标签的元素

在HTML5中 ,有些元素可以省略标签,具体有以下3种情况。

1.不允许写结束标签的元素有area、base、br、col、command、embed、hr、img、
input、keygen、link、meta、param、soure、track、wbr。
不允许写结束标记的元素是指不允许使用开始标记与结束标记将元素括起来的形式,
只允许使用“<元素/>”的形式进行书写。例如,"<br>...</br>"的写法是错误的,应该写成
“<br/>”,但是沿袭下来的“<br>”的写法也是允许的。

2.可以省略结束标签的元素有li/dt/dd/p/rt/rp/optgroup/option/colgroup/thread/tbody/
tfoot/tr/td/th。

3.可以省略整个标签的元素有:html/head/body/colgroup/tbody。
需要注意的是,虽然这些元素可以省略,但实际上却是隐式存在的,
例如,<body>标签可以省略,但在DOM树上它是存在的。
上述元素中也包括了HTML5的新元素,有些新元素的用法,将在后面的章节详细讲解。

二、取得boolean值得属性

取得布尔值(boolean)的属性,如在disabled和readonly等,
通过省略属性的值来表达“值为true”时,可以将属性值设为属性名称本身,也可以将值设为空字符串,
代码如下。
<input type="checkbox" chenked>
<input type="checkbox" checked="checked">
<input type="checkbox" checked="">

三、省略属性的引用符

设置属性值时,可以使用双引号或单引号来引用。HTML5语法则更进一步,只要属性值不包含空格
、<>、'、"、`、=等字符,都可以省略属性的引用符。代码如下。
<input type="text">
<input tyoe=‘text’>
<input type=text>
0
0
查看评论

html5的技术要点

转载备用
  • foren_whb
  • foren_whb
  • 2016-03-11 14:21
  • 718

分分钟搞定Html5的基本语法(一)

在HTML5中,有不少新的富含语义的元素,可以向浏览器和开发人员传达元素的用途。
  • u014078192
  • u014078192
  • 2014-04-28 17:11
  • 2567

HTML5移动开发技术要点总结及各事件含义

如果你是一名前端er,又想在移动设备上开发出自己的应用,那怎么实现呢?幸好,webkit内核的浏览器能帮助我们完成这一切。接触 webkit webApp的开发已经有一段时间了,现把一些技巧分享给大家 :  1. viewport: 也就是可视区域。对于桌面浏览器,我们都很...
  • zxf13598202302
  • zxf13598202302
  • 2016-02-23 16:56
  • 588

关于python刷题的语法要点

list a, bb = a, it is just a reference assignment. a改变,b也改变b = a[:], it is copy. a 改变,b不变
  • xyqzki
  • xyqzki
  • 2015-12-13 22:23
  • 445

C#基础部分之语法和基础知识

 C#的入口函数Main有以下形式无入口参数、无返回值1    public class HelloWorld2    {34     &#...
  • shyleoking
  • shyleoking
  • 2007-01-31 09:41
  • 669

html5如何创建按钮button

HTML 5 标签 定义和用法 标签定义按钮。您可以在 button 元素中放置内容,比如文档或图像。这是该元素与由 input 元素创建的按钮的不同之处。 HTML 4.01 与 HTML 5 之间的差异 在 HTML 5 中有一个新属性:autofocus。 例子: TestBtn...
  • jangdong
  • jangdong
  • 2013-09-28 11:31
  • 1842

html5 基本语法详解

HTML头部标记 标记 描述 HTML5标准 定义页面中所有链接的基准URL   设定显示在浏览器左上方的标题内容   表明该文档是一个可用于检索的网关脚本 不支持 文档本身的元信息,例如查询关键词,...
  • mazegong
  • mazegong
  • 2016-05-03 09:28
  • 567

js 的基本语法

<br />JavaScript的运行环境和代码位置<br />编写JavaScript脚本不需要任何特殊的软件,一个文本编辑器和一个Web浏览器就足够了,JavaScript代码就是运行在Web浏览器中。<br />用JavaScript编写的代码必须嵌在一份h...
  • qianhe_he
  • qianhe_he
  • 2010-09-14 15:27
  • 7053

前端必会的html知识总结整理

1.浏览器内核 ie:trident(三叉戟)内核 firefox:gecko(壁虎)内核 safari:webkit(浏览器核心)内核 opera:以前是presto(急速)内核,现在是和谷歌共同开发的blink(闪烁)内核 chrome:blink(基于webkit,谷歌和opera softw...
  • u014346301
  • u014346301
  • 2016-12-27 11:33
  • 5022

javascript HTML静态页面传值的四种方法

https://www.cnblogs.com/EdwinChan/p/6387056.html?utm_source=itdadao&utm_medium=referral
  • hua77f
  • hua77f
  • 2017-12-26 13:18
  • 36
    个人资料
    • 访问:13027次
    • 积分:505
    • 等级:
    • 排名:千里之外
    • 原创:38篇
    • 转载:1篇
    • 译文:0篇
    • 评论:4条
    文章分类